Transaction 8566f2c4760434270b3a5e53372017bac8d15f23265f095ad36fa6c641273599

1 Input
2 Outputs
  • 8566f2c4760434270b3a5e53372017bac8d15f23265f095ad36fa6c641273599:0
  • value  70233156
    address  3NYrbaCpbTCHq6jWyes8qxrfiYDrqGSQze
  • 8566f2c4760434270b3a5e53372017bac8d15f23265f095ad36fa6c641273599:1
  • value  180000
    address  3KGZxzJModuXty7S6vb72EfnXyp7ttb91C